1. Income annuities. An income annuity is a contract between you and an insurance company where you pay a sum of money, either all at once or monthly, in exchange for regular income payments. Annuities can help you set up a guaranteed income stream for a certain period of time or for the rest of your life. Dividends are regular (but not guaranteed) payments that are shared with ...Fixed-Income Securities. Fixed-income securities can pay out interest or dividends to you on a monthly basis, often with minimal risk. Examples of fixed-income securities can include bonds, money market funds and brokered certificates of deposit (CDs) that earn a fixed interest rate.
